Bollinger Band

Bollinger Bands are a technical analysis tool, defined by a set of bands plotted relative to a moving average. Developed by John Bollinger in the 1980s, they are used to measure a market’s volatility and to identify potential overbought or oversold conditions in the price of an asset. This article will detail the components of Bollinger Bands, how they are calculated, and how traders use them in cryptocurrency futures trading.

Components of Bollinger Bands

Bollinger Bands consist of three lines:

  • Middle Band: This is a simple moving average (SMA), typically a 20-period SMA. The period can be adjusted by the trader, but 20 is the most common setting. It represents the average price over the specified period.
  • Upper Band: Calculated by adding a specified number of standard deviations (typically two) to the middle band. This represents the potential upper resistance level.
  • Lower Band: Calculated by subtracting the same number of standard deviations from the middle band. This represents the potential lower support level.

The standard deviation measures the dispersion of prices around the moving average. A higher standard deviation indicates higher volatility, resulting in wider bands. Conversely, a lower standard deviation indicates lower volatility, resulting in narrower bands.

Calculating Bollinger Bands

Let's break down the calculation with an example:

1. Calculate the Simple Moving Average (SMA): Sum the closing prices of the last 20 periods and divide by 20. 2. Calculate the Standard Deviation: Determine the standard deviation of the closing prices over the same 20 periods. This involves calculating the variance and then taking its square root. 3. Calculate the Upper Band: Add two times the standard deviation to the 20-period SMA. 4. Calculate the Lower Band: Subtract two times the standard deviation from the 20-period SMA.

Component Formula
Middle Band (SMA) Sum of closing prices over N periods / N
Upper Band SMA + (Standard Deviation * Multiplier)
Lower Band SMA - (Standard Deviation * Multiplier)

Where N is the period (typically 20) and the Multiplier is usually 2.

Interpreting Bollinger Bands

Bollinger Bands provide several signals for traders:

  • High Volatility: When the bands widen, it suggests increasing volatility in the market. This often happens during periods of significant price movement, such as during major news events or market corrections.
  • Low Volatility: When the bands narrow, it suggests decreasing volatility. This can indicate a period of consolidation or a potential breakout. This is often referred to as a Bollinger Squeeze.
  • Overbought/Oversold Conditions: Prices touching or exceeding the upper band may suggest an overbought condition, potentially signaling a price reversal or profit taking. Prices touching or exceeding the lower band may suggest an oversold condition, potentially signaling a price bounce or accumulation. However, these signals are not always reliable, especially in strong trending markets.
  • Price Breakouts: A price breaking above the upper band can be a bullish signal, indicating a potential continuation of the uptrend. Conversely, a price breaking below the lower band can be a bearish signal, indicating a potential continuation of the downtrend. These are often confirmed with volume analysis.
  • W Pattern & M Pattern: These patterns formed within the bands can hint at potential reversals. A "W" pattern near the lower band can suggest a bullish reversal, while an "M" pattern near the upper band can suggest a bearish reversal. These require confirmation with other chart patterns.

Trading Strategies Using Bollinger Bands

Several trading strategies incorporate Bollinger Bands:

  • Bollinger Bounce: This strategy involves buying when the price touches the lower band (assuming an oversold condition) and selling when the price touches the upper band (assuming an overbought condition). It is crucial to use risk management techniques like stop-loss orders.
  • Bollinger Squeeze Breakout: This strategy involves identifying periods of low volatility (narrowing bands) and then entering a trade in the direction of the breakout when the bands widen. Candlestick patterns can help confirm the breakout direction.
  • Bollinger Band Width: Monitoring the width of the bands can help identify potential trading opportunities. An increasing band width suggests increasing volatility, while a decreasing band width suggests decreasing volatility. This integrates with volatility analysis.
  • Combining with Other Indicators: Bollinger Bands are often used in conjunction with other technical indicators, such as the Relative Strength Index (RSI), Moving Average Convergence Divergence (MACD), and Fibonacci retracements, to confirm trading signals. On-Balance Volume (OBV) is useful in confirming momentum.
  • Trend Following with Bollinger Bands: Using the bands to define trailing stop-loss orders in a trending market. The middle band can act as a dynamic support or resistance level during a trending market.

Limitations of Bollinger Bands

While Bollinger Bands are a valuable tool, they have limitations:

  • Whipsaws: In sideways or choppy markets, the price can frequently touch or cross the bands, generating false signals (whipsaws).
  • Subjectivity: The interpretation of Bollinger Band signals can be subjective.
  • Not a Standalone System: Bollinger Bands should not be used as a standalone trading system. They are best used in conjunction with other technical analysis tools and fundamental analysis.
  • Parameter Sensitivity: The effectiveness of Bollinger Bands can be sensitive to the chosen period and standard deviation multiplier. Optimization is often required.
  • Lagging Indicator: As they are based on moving averages, Bollinger Bands are lagging indicators, meaning they react to past price data.

Advanced Considerations

  • Walk-Forward Analysis: A method to optimize parameters and test the robustness of a Bollinger Band strategy.
  • Multiple Timeframe Analysis: Analyzing Bollinger Bands on different timeframes (e.g., 15-minute, hourly, daily) to gain a more comprehensive view of the market.
  • Bollinger Bands and Volume: Confirming signals with volume spikes can increase the probability of success. Increasing volume on a breakout from the bands often validates the move.
  • Using Bollinger Bands to Identify Support and Resistance: The bands can act as dynamic support and resistance levels.
  • Understanding Band Expansion and Contraction: Analyzing the rate of band expansion and contraction can provide insights into the strength of a trend.
